At the indicated time, the evening will begin once you take your seats in the Red Heritage Theatre and Restaurant. This is a venue owned by the Navajo people of Page, where you'll enjoy an immersive experience where flavour, music and dance are intertwined in a display of living culture.
At this theatre, you'll enjoy a delicious dinner featuring the Navajo taco, a crispy bread with meat, sour cream, avocado, cheese, sweet chilli and lettuce. The sweet touch will be provided by dessert and a soft drink. For the kids, a traditional cheeseburger, fries, chicken strips, dessert and a soft drink will be served. As the flavours melt on your tongue, the light will dim and the show will begin.
On the stage, you'll see the dancers dressed in traditional Navajo costumes full of colour, feathers and bells. Each piece and each step tells a story! The most breathtaking moment will be the hoop dance, when the dancer, using multiple hoops, will represent the connection between the natural elements and the cycles of life.
In short, you'll witness a powwow, or gathering of the native people of North America, where not only impressive skills are shared, but also memory, pride and cultural resilience. At the end of the Navajo dance performance, you'll be able to talk to the dancers and take photographs, taking with you a piece of the living history of this ancestral community.
